I'm a U.S. person and I recently incorporated a company in Ireland for tax and business reasons. I transferred ownership of my software intellectual property (valued at approximately $2 million based on a recent third-party valuation) to the Irish company in exchange for shares. A friend who went through something similar said I need to file Form 926. Is this correct? What are the consequences of this transfer for U.S. tax purposes?
